About this book

This revised Sixth Edition presents the basic fundamentals on a level appropriate for college students who have completed their freshmen calculus, chemistry, and physics courses. All subject matter is presented in a logical order, from the simple tothe more complex. Each chapter builds on the content of previous ones. In order to expedite the learning process, the book provides:

  • "Concept Check" questions to test conceptual understanding
  • End-of-chapter questions and problems to develop understanding of concepts and problem-solving skills
  • End-of-book Answers to Selected Problems to check accuracy of work
  • End-of chapter summary tables containing key equations and equation symbols
  • A glossary for easy reference
